MMA ref watches dangerous choke hold for 10 seconds before stopping fight

An MMA fight that was billed as the "St.Paddy's Day Showdown 3" could have been the final showdown for one cage fighter's life. Watch as the referee stands by and watches the poor guy go completely limp while being choked out and then just stands over the fighter trying to take what could have been his last gasps of air around for over 10 seconds.

At first, the referee taps the limp body of the fighter — maybe to make sure he's not playing possum —then waits a few more seconds before ending the fight.

It's amazingly obvious the guy is out cold and unable to tap out. What's more is amazing that the one guy in the ring there to keep someone from killing the other guy wasn't doing his job.
